Best Materials for Restaurant Dining Chairs
The material of a dining chair affects its durability, comfort, appearance, and maintenance.
Let’s look at some popular options.
Wooden Dining Chairs
Wooden chairs are one of the most popular choices for restaurants. They give a warm, natural, and timeless look that works with many restaurant styles.
Benefits of Wooden Chairs:
- Strong and durable
- Stylish appearance
- Long-lasting performance
- Available in many colors and finishes
- Comfortable and stable
Hardwood materials like walnut, oak, and teak are excellent for restaurant use.
Wooden restaurant dining chairs work especially well in:
- Fine dining restaurants
- Cafes
- Family restaurants
- Rustic interiors

Metal Dining Chairs
Metal chairs are another great option for high-traffic restaurants. They are known for their strength and low maintenance.
Advantages of Metal Chairs:
- Very durable
- Lightweight and easy to move
- Easy to clean
- Modern industrial look
- Suitable for indoor and outdoor use
Metal chairs are commonly used in cafes, fast-food restaurants, and modern dining spaces.

Upholstered Dining Chairs
Upholstered chairs add extra comfort and luxury. These chairs are perfect for restaurants where customers spend more time dining.
Best Upholstery Materials:
- Faux leather
- Vinyl
- Commercial fabric
- Performance fabric
These materials are easier to clean and maintain compared to regular fabric.
Why Restaurants Choose Upholstered Chairs:
- Better comfort
- Elegant appearance
- Premium dining experience
- Soft seating support
However, restaurants should always choose stain-resistant and easy-clean upholstery.
Plastic Dining Chairs
Modern plastic chairs are affordable, lightweight, and practical.
They work well in:
- Outdoor restaurants
- Cafeterias
- Casual dining areas
- Budget-friendly cafes
Today’s plastic chairs come in stylish modern designs while still offering good durability.
How to Choose Dining Chairs for High-Traffic Restaurants
Busy restaurants need furniture that can survive daily wear and tear.
Here are some important things to check before buying restaurant dining chairs.
1. Strong Frame Construction
Always check the frame quality.
A strong frame helps chairs stay stable for many years.
Solid wood and reinforced metal frames are excellent choices.
Avoid weak joints or low-quality materials.
2. Comfortable Seating
Comfort is very important. Customers enjoy dining longer when seating feels comfortable.
Look for:
- Proper back support
- Soft cushioning
- Comfortable seat height
- Smooth armrests
Good seating improves the overall customer experience.
3. Easy Maintenance
Restaurant furniture gets dirty quickly. Food spills, drinks, and dust are common.
Choose chairs that are:
- Easy to wipe clean
- Stain-resistant
- Moisture-resistant
- Low maintenance
Easy-clean furniture helps save staff time.
4. Scratch Resistance
Restaurant chairs are moved constantly.
Durable finishes help protect chairs from scratches and marks.
This keeps your restaurant looking clean and professional.
5. Lightweight but Strong Design
Restaurant staff move chairs frequently while cleaning or rearranging tables.
Lightweight chairs make daily operations easier.
But they should still be strong enough for commercial use.

Simple Maintenance Tips for Restaurant Dining Chairs
Even durable chairs need proper care.
Regular maintenance helps chairs last longer.
Helpful Maintenance Tips:
1.Clean Chairs Daily
Wipe surfaces regularly to remove dust and stains.
2.Tighten Loose Screws
Check joints and screws regularly.
3.Use Floor Protectors
Chair leg protectors help prevent scratches.
4.Avoid Excess Water
Too much moisture can damage wooden furniture.
5.Rotate Chairs
Rotating seating evenly helps reduce wear.
Taking care of commercial dining chairs improves their lifespan.
